>>65590297
Eh. Sounds like a bunch of presets thrown together in various patterns. Not much here for structure, either. Drum samples are pretty flat as well. The only thing that I like is the occasional jazzy synth solo that occurs. I think jazzy idm like this has to be way more wonky (tone-wise) and chordally interesting to have any effect.

>>65590241
This is certainly your least offensive album art! Its much more subtle (which is what the other cover needed). As for the music... it sounds like glitch! There's not much development or randomness to keep me interested which are usual staples of glitch. I do enjoy the sounds and tones that you've created; it's just that none of the music interests me. Wreichant is probably the best crop on this album though (that disjointed rhythmic pulse is tight).

>>65590538
Engineering isn't that good which is a shame for your band. The vocalist is great, the glide guitar tone is perfect, and the drumming is good (although, they sound like shit in the mix; particularly the snare sounds flat as hell and has no punch). I don't know if it's distortion or not but the rhythm guitar has this fart-fuzz sound to it (not the good kind of fuzz either; the fuzz that's associated with bad recording equipment)
